Welcome to the forum, I can only comment on your "hot motor" issue. So you replaced the T-stat and it's not pissin water and getting hot? Have you tried to clean out the water passages yet? I had the same problems with a smaller Yamaha and what happen was that all the water passages were clogged with salt-water build-up since the PO never flushed. It took some time to clean out the passages but the motor finally had a steady, strong ****-stream and no hot motorhead. When you replaced the t-stat was there alot of salt-build up in that area? That's how i unclogged my yamaha, remove t-stat flush or soak with vinagar&water mix and then blow compressed air. After doing this several times the motor spit out some salt-crud and was peeing pretty strong. The vinagar&water mix i used was suggested by a friend and i don't think it would hurt the motor and was cheap to use instead of the overpriced salt-away products they sell in the marine stores.
